Backyard slab construction involves creating a solid, level concrete surface in the outdoor space of a property. This service typically includes preparing the ground, pouring the concrete, and finishing it to ensure durability and a clean appearance. Homeowners often choose this option to establish a stable foundation for outdoor features such as patios, walkways, or outdoor kitchens. Properly constructed slabs can enhance the usability of a backyard, providing a flat, even surface suitable for various outdoor activities and furniture.

This service helps address common problems like uneven or cracked surfaces that can pose safety hazards or limit outdoor enjoyment. Over time, ground shifting, soil erosion, or weather conditions may cause existing concrete to settle or deteriorate. A new backyard slab can resolve these issues by replacing or upgrading older surfaces, offering a safer, more attractive area for family gatherings, barbecues, or relaxation. Additionally, a well-built concrete slab can improve drainage and prevent water pooling, reducing the risk of damage to surrounding landscaping or structures.

The overview below groups typical Backyard Slab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Marysville,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ine backyard slab repairs in Marysville range from $250 to $600. Many projects in this category involve fixing cracks or surface damage and tend to fall in the middle of this range. Fewer repairs reach the higher end for extensive patching or surface leveling.

Basic Patio Slabs - Installing a new concrete slab for a patio us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000. Local contractors often see many projects within this range, depending on size and design complexity. Larger, more elaborate patios can push costs above $3,500, but these are less common.

Full Replacement - Replacing an existing backyard slab with a new one typically costs from $3,000 to $7,000. Most full replacements fall into this range, with larger or more detailed projects reaching higher costs. Smaller, straightforward replacements tend to stay toward the lower end.

Complex or Custom Projects - Custom designs, stamped concrete, or large-scale installations can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and usually involve detailed work or high-end finishes that increase overall cost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of backyard slabs do local contractors typically install? Local contractors often install concrete, paver, and stamped concrete slabs to suit various outdoor spaces and preferences.

How can I ensure my backyard slab is durable and long-lasting? Choosing experienced service providers who use quality materials and proper installation techniques can help ensure the longevity of a backyard slab.

What factors influence the suitability of a particular slab for my backyard? Factors such as soil condition, usage needs, and aesthetic preferences are considered by local contractors when recommending the best slab type.

Are there different styles or finishes available for backyard slabs? Yes, local service providers offer a variety of finishes, including stamped, textured, and colored options to enhance outdoor spaces.

How do local contractors prepare the site before installing a backyard slab? Site preparation typically involves clearing, leveling, and sometimes excavating the area to ensure a stable foundation for the slab.
